We contacted Olympic Movers to help us do a local move in under a week. They came out and gave an estimate based on the amount of men, time and equipment that would be needed to complete the move and we agreed. The day of they showed up on time, worked courteously and diligently. Overall we were impressed with the work the movers performed.
For the initial estimate they company insisted that a veteran member of the stuff visit the apartment to assess the job. The proposal offered by management was 4 men for 4 hours at the first location and 3 men for 3 hours at the second. On the day we only had 4 men for 1.25 hours and then 3 men for 11 hours. Our final bill was 26% higher than the estimate. I understand that an estimate is just that, and that it may take longer than you originally thought. However, if there is a drastic difference in what was planned and what was delivered in terms of man hours I think it's fair to ask for some consideration. When I asked management to decrease the bill to something more reasonable (which would still be 16% over the estimate; they refused). In addition they started applying pressure to me and my wife to pay immediately. They called my wife the day they emailed us their bill of loading asking for payment. They then called repeatedly the next day demanding payment, threatening enforcement of their contract and trying to drive up the pressure to get paid as soon as possible. The man had the gall to say that we should give them a good review since they showed up and worked so hard (this was the manager/assessor, he was not working as a mover that day). Again, I understand in this industry it can be difficult to collect on a service that was already delivered, but that was really not necessary here and using these tactics within one business day (we moved Friday, they emailed us the receipt Monday and started the pressure on Tuesday) of a major event seemed unwarranted.
Overall would I recommend Olympic Movers? I guess I might with some caveats. Their movers did a fantastic job. However, their billing and sales leave a lot to be desired. If money is not a concern I would recommend them; if it is I'd recommend a larger or more reputable company that will deal with you more fairly. I say this because:
- They made an estimate based on their own assessment of the job, changed the agreed upon allocation of men and failed to deliver within their time-frame which ended up costing us more.
- They refused to accept responsibility on their end for the higher cost and refused to accept a fair compromise for failing to meet their estimate.
- They employed high pressure tactics to collect their money and solicit a positive review.
